Denham is a charming coastal town located in Western Australia. If you are planning to visit this beautiful destination, there are several ways to reach Denham:
The nearest major airport to Denham is Perth Airport, which is located approximately 850 kilometers away. From Perth, you can take a domestic flight to Shark Bay Airport in Monkey Mia, which is just a short drive from Denham. Several airlines operate regular flights to Shark Bay Airport, making it a convenient option for travelers.
If you prefer a road trip, Denham is accessible via the North West Coastal Highway. The journey from Perth to Denham takes approximately 10-12 hours, depending on traffic and stops along the way. The highway offers scenic views of the Western Australian landscape, making the drive enjoyable and memorable.
Another option to reach Denham is by bus. Several bus companies operate services from Perth to Denham, providing a comfortable and affordable transportation option. The bus journey takes around 12-14 hours, allowing you to relax and enjoy the picturesque countryside during the trip.
If you prefer a more adventurous and scenic route, you can also reach Denham by sea. There are cruise companies that offer trips to Shark Bay, allowing you to explore the stunning coastline and marine life along the way. This option provides a unique and memorable experience for travelers.

Denham is a picturesque town located on the shore of the Shark Bay in Western Australia. It is approximately 831 kilometers north of Perth, the state capital. Known for its pristine beaches and calm waters, Denham is a popular destination for tourists seeking relaxation and adventure.
The town is surrounded by national parks and reserves, including Shark Bay Marine Park, Francois Peron National Park, and Monkey Mia Reserve. Visitors to Denham can enjoy a variety of water activities such as swimming, fishing, kayaking, and boating.
Denham has a small population of approximately 755 people and offers a range of accommodations, including hotels, motels, holiday parks, and campgrounds. The town's main street is home to a few cafes, restaurants, and shops selling souvenirs and beach gear.
